Cattle Egrets and dry fish business in coastal areas Nature Precedings
Kotta Seedikkoya; PA Azeezpa.
Cattle Egret is one of the common wetland birds in India known for its efficiency to make use of human interfered habitats. The present study is an attempt to document maggots of houseflies and calliphorids in the coastal sun drying fish yards and the role of the species in containing the vector species. The number of flies and maggots were found related with the visit of cattle egrets, demonstrating the importance of the species in controlling the vectors.

Why overlearned sequences are special: distinct neural networks in the right hemisphere for ordinal sequences Nature Precedings
Vani Pariyadath; Sara J. Churchill; David M. Eagleman.
Written and spoken words activate left hemisphere areas involved in language processing. However, we here show that overlearned sequences (e.g. letters, numbers, weekdays, months) involve an unexpected right hemispheric activation in both the middle temporal gyrus and temporoparietal junction. Our findings offer a framework for understanding neuropsychological patterns seen in conditions such as synesthesia, in which anomalous perceptual experiences are triggered by overlearned sequences, and also in semantic dementia, in which left hemisphere damage disrupts word knowledge even while sequences can be spared.

A sensorimotor area (NIf) is required for the production of learned vocalizations Nature Precedings
Sharon M. H. Gobes; Bence P. Ölveczky.
Sensory feedback is essential for the acquisition of complex motor behaviors, including birdsong. In zebra finches, auditory feedback is relayed to the descending motor pathway primarily through the nucleus interfacialis nidopalii (NIf). NIf projects to HVC - a premotor region essential for song, which projects to RA, a motor cortex analogue brain area that drives muscle activity required for vocalizations. NIf is also essential for ‘sleep replay’, a recapitulation of song-related neural dynamics in the motor pathway during sleep. Despite being one of the major inputs to the song control pathway, there is no known role for NIf in the production of zebra finch song. A new potential radiosensitizer: ammonium persulfate modified WCNTs Nature Precedings
Jian-She Yang; Bo-Zhang Yu; Wen-Xin Li.
Radiotherapy plays a very important role in cancer treatment. Radiosensitizers have been widely used to enhance the radiosensitivity of cancer cells at given radiations. Here we fabricate multi-walled carbon nanotubes with ammonium persulfate, and get very short samples with 30-50 nanometer length. Cell viability assay show that f-WCNTs induce cell death significantly. We hypothesize that free radicals originated from hydroxyl and carbonyl groups on the surface of f-WCNTs lead cell damage.

Metastasis as a faulty recapitulation of ontogeny Nature Precedings
Ulf R. Rapp.
RAF oncogenes are involved in a variety of phenotypic switch phenomena. If for example oncogenic RAF is expressed together with Myc in B lineage cells, a lineage switch to macrophages occurs at low frequency in vitro and in vivo. In addition, if RAF is expressed in type II alveolar epithelial cells slow growing lung adenomas are formed and a switch from columnar to cuboidal cells is detected in these mice upon p53 deletion. A similar switch is also seen, if ectopic Myc is present in our lung tumor mouse model. Moreover, in the liver of these mice with both oncogenes metastases are found. TMEPAI, a transmembrane TGF-β-inducible protein, sequesters Smad proteins in TGF-β signaling Nature Precedings
Susumu Itoh; Yukihide Watanabe; Kiyotoshi Satoh; Masako Inamitsu; Liang Shi; Naoko Nakano; Aya Tanaka; Eliza Wiercinska; Hiroshi Shibuya; Peter ten Dijke; Mitsuyasu Kato.
Transforming growth factor-[beta] (TGF-[beta]) is a multifunctional cytokine of key importance for controlling embryogenesis and tissue homeostasis. How TGF-[beta] signals are attenuated and terminated is not well understood. Here, we show that TMEPAI, a direct target gene of TGF-[beta] signaling, antagonizes TGF-[beta] signaling by interfering with TGF-[beta] type I receptor (T[beta]RI)-induced R-Smad phosphorylation. TMEPAI can directly interact with R-Smads via a Smad interaction motif (SIM). TMEPAI competes with Smad anchor for receptor activation (SARA) for R-Smad binding, thereby sequestering R-Smads from T[beta]RI kinase activation.
